Why Do My Car Lock Freeze . Moister can enter the crevices of a car door, worn gaskets, torn weatherstripping, wet keys, or broken keyhole covers. if your car lock or even the whole door is frozen shut, we’re here to help. Once the moisture has accumulated, all it needs is cold enough weather to freeze. car doors could get frozen due to a rapid drop in temperature, causing the moisture around the lock to freeze.
